Look, let's be real - Turkey's been wrestling with energy costs like it's some sort of Greco-Roman oil wrestling match. With electricity prices jumping 127% since 2019 (Energy Market Regulatory Authority data), businesses are desperately seeking solar solutions that don't require massive upfront investment. Enter retractable container systems - the "swiss army knife" of renewable energy.
Imagine this: A textile factory in Bursa spends ₺4.2 million annually on power. Their roof? Completely unsuitable for traditional panels. But here's the kicker - they've got 3 acres of unused parking space. That's where containerized systems shine, literally. These mobile units can generate 480 MWh/year while occupying less ground space than fixed installations.

Now, let's talk numbers. Current solar container quotations in Turkey range from $68,000 to $210,000 per unit. Why the huge spread? Three often-overlooked factors:
A client in Gaziantep paid 18% less by opting for locally sourced lithium batteries. But wait - there's a catch. Some domestic batteries degrade 27% faster in high temperatures. See the dilemma? That's why smart solar container quotations always include climate-specific performance guarantees.
Turkey's new Green Credit program offers 12-year loans at 7.9% APR for solar container projects. Pair that with the 32% ROI typical users see within 4 years, and you've got a no-brainer. With EU carbon border taxes looming, Turkish exporters using solar containers could avoid $28/ton CO2 fees. For a medium-sized steel exporter, that's $4.7 million annual savings. Suddenly, those solar panel container costs look like pocket change, don't they?
